- [ ] **Step 7: Breaker override escrow.** After sealing the signing keys for the Tallgrove upstream API circuit breaker, confirm the support team can force the breaker open during a full outage. The override bundle lives in the sealed escrow drawer and is useless without its unlock phrase. Two ceremony witnesses must initial this step before proceeding. The escrow bundle is decrypted with the recovery passphrase that follows.

vault phrase of kahip-kahop = holath-quenmir

MEMO — Support Outsourcing

To the incoming director: Tier-1 customer support moves to Quillar Services in Q2. Pilot ran eight weeks; CSAT held steady, cost down 18%. Internal team shifts to Tier-2 and escalations. Transition plan owned by Renna Volkas. Comms to staff go out after board sign-off. Full context on the strategy is in the note below.

confidential, kagep-kahof: Druokax Systems plans to lower the Ulaath list price by 53 percent in March.

**14:22 UTC** — The Gatewright gateway at Corvello began rejecting valid traffic after the rate limiter's token bucket config was hot-reloaded with a zeroed burst value. If you're new here: the limiter reads config every five minutes, so the bad value propagated gradually, which is why dashboards showed a slow climb in 429s rather than a cliff. On-call rolled back at 14:41. The offending build is identified below.

trace token, kawip-fafog: htk14_26e64c4d35154e

Runbook: Fleet fuel-usage report (Haulwick)

Future maintainers, hello. The monthly fuel report aggregates odometer and pump logs from the Haulwick depots and lands in the ops dashboard around the 3rd. If it's missing, first check the Burnsight aggregator job — it's flaky when a depot uploads late. Rerun with the --backfill flag, never --force (it double-counts, learned that the hard way). The job authenticates to our internal telemetry service, Pipewren, and you'll need its key exported first. That key is below.

app token of kawif-yafop = zpat2_88

Handover for Priya — dock basics at Marrowgate. Deliveries run 8am to 2pm, Monday to Friday; Saturdays are refusals only. The Kestrel Freight lot always arrive early, so expect buzzing from 7:45. Log everything in the dock sheet before lunch. The shutter control panel is behind the noticeboard, and it needs the code below to operate.

badge for fafop-fajof: bdg-Z-47